What are the most common Acura repair issues for vehicles driven in the Indian Wells, AZ, climate?

The extreme desert heat and dust in Indian Wells are particularly hard on cooling systems and air conditioning compressors, which are frequent Acura repair needs. Batteries also tend to have a shorter lifespan due to the constant high temperatures, making electrical system checks vital during service.

When should I seek immediate service for my Acura when driving on local desert roads?

Seek immediate service if you notice overheating warnings, as desert driving strains the cooling system, or if you experience any steering or suspension issues after driving on unpaved rural roads common to the area. Ignoring these can lead to more severe damage.

What local driving conditions should I tell my mechanic about during an Acura service in Indian Wells?

Always inform your mechanic about frequent driving on dusty, unpaved roads and long highway trips in extreme heat. This context helps them prioritize inspections for the air filtration system, cooling system, and tire wear, which are all impacted by these specific conditions.
